643511
0000000000000000000a60023595743fda3765c604e55e3b908713a44d42e94b
Time
08-13-2020 18:05:33 (Local)
Sponsored
Transaction Fees
0.02780674
BTC
Confirmations
273093
Total Amounts
575752.01911865 USDT
Transaction Counts
84
Previous Block:
Merkle Root:
4520a361f3692462fbed83cad8f1f04447cb4669f66cef29d496e28e999ffe18